Output ddb614fae119e92d6a9b5919eaac200749b323c90e3d6cce074000e25611cfdc:0

value
56900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da3b8322dfa5637e1dd75db4604e0360c13486c4 OP_EQUAL
address
MTo4qETjaPCDjFeV6atkpAG5HP1n6pY5Cw
transaction
ddb614fae119e92d6a9b5919eaac200749b323c90e3d6cce074000e25611cfdc
spent
true